Build And Release Engineer salary in Romania

Average Yearly Salary of Build And Release Engineer in Romania is approximately 144,250 RON (28,851 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

What does Build And Release Engineer do?

occupation personasA build and release engineer is responsible for managing the process of creating software builds and releasing them to production environments. They work closely with development teams to ensure that code changes are properly integrated, tested, and deployed. This role involves setting up and maintaining build systems, version control systems, and continuous integration/delivery pipelines. Build and release engineers also collaborate with various stakeholders to define release strategies, manage dependencies, and troubleshoot issues related to the build and release process.

Skills: Build management, Release engineering, Continuous integration, Deployment automation, Version control systems, Software configuration management.
Job industry: Software development

Salary increase per years of experience

Based on data available the salary increase per years of experience is as following

    0 years (beginner) equals base salary
    1 to 5 years of experience yields up arrow+12% salary increase
    6 to 10 years of experience yields up arrow+25% salary increase
    11 to 15 years of experience yields up arrow+16% salary increase
    16 to 25 years of experience yields up arrow+9% salary increase
    more than 25 years of experience yields up arrow+10% salary increase
NOTE: Details based on limited set of data. Percentages may vary. The salary increase over years of experience can vary widely based on factors such as job industry, job role, location, company size, and individual performance.
